What is a sales electronic components broker?

A Sales Electronic Components Broker is a professional who acts as an intermediary between buyers and sellers of electronic components, such as semiconductors, resistors, and integrated circuits. Their role involves sourcing hard-to-find or obsolete parts, negotiating prices, and ensuring timely delivery to meet clients' needs. Brokers often have extensive industry contacts and market knowledge, enabling them to find the best deals and reliable suppliers. They also help manage supply chain risks and may provide value-added services like quality assurance or logistics support.

What are the typical challenges faced in a sales electronic components brokerage role, and how can they be addressed?

Professionals in Sales Electronic Components Brokerage often encounter challenges such as rapidly changing market prices, sourcing hard-to-find components, and managing supply chain disruptions. To address these issues, successful brokers build strong relationships with reliable suppliers, stay updated on market trends, and develop effective negotiation skills. Additionally, leveraging technology and maintaining clear communication with clients helps ensure transparency and trust throughout the transaction process.

IDEX Corporation is a global leader in fluid and metering technologies, providing a wide range of solutions for various industries. With a diverse portfolio of highly engineered products, IDEX serves customers in sectors such as healthcare, life sciences, food and beverage, water and wastewater, energy, and more. IDEX's innovative solutions help their customers optimize processes, enhance efficiency, and improve safety. IDEX's product offerings include precision fluid handling systems, pumps, valves, meters, dispensing equipment, and other specialty products. These technologies are designed to meet rigorous standards and deliver reliable performance in critical applications.
